【问题描述】:
我正在为 golang 学习 fyne.io,我遇到了一个问题。我做了一个最小的仪表板交互任务,应该同时开始,问题是用户必须有权随时停止任何任务。我决定使用通道来发送任务和上下文来停止任务,但这不起作用,我的意思是当任务到达通道时,worker(task *Task) 开始,我点击停止,当这种情况发生时,startTask(task *Task) 停止工作,但@987654324 @不停。怎么了?我做错了吗?
package main
import (
"context"
"fmt"
"fyne.io/fyne/v2"
"fyne.io/fyne/v2/app"
"fyne.io/fyne/v2/container"
"fyne.io/fyne/v2/theme"
"fyne.io/fyne/v2/widget"
"github.com/k0kubun/pp"
"time"
)
type Task struct {
ID int
Chancel context.CancelFunc
}
var channelTask chan *Task
func worker(task *Task) {
for i := 0; i < 10; i ++ {
fmt.Println(fmt.Sprintf("Task ID: %d running...%d", task.ID, i))
time.Sleep(1 * time.Second)
}
}
func startTask(task *Task) {
go func() {
ctx, cancel := context.WithCancel(context.Background())
for {
select {
case <- ctx.Done():
pp.Println(fmt.Sprintf("Task ID: %d stopped!", task.ID))
return
case task := <-channelTask:
task.Chancel = cancel
fmt.Println(fmt.Sprintf("Task ID: %d stared!", task.ID))
go func() {
worker(task)
}()
default:
continue
}
}
}()
}
func main() {
a := app.New()
w := a.NewWindow("Testing")
channelTask = make(chan *Task)
w.SetContent(createList())
w.CenterOnScreen()
w.Resize(fyne.Size{
Width: 500,
Height: 300,
})
w.SetFixedSize(true)
w.ShowAndRun()
}
func createList() *widget.List {
tasks := createTasks()
return widget.NewList(
func() int {
return len(tasks)
},
func() fyne.CanvasObject {
return container.NewGridWithColumns(3,
widget.NewLabel(""),
widget.NewButtonWithIcon("Run", theme.MediaPlayIcon(), func() {}),
widget.NewButtonWithIcon("Stop", theme.MediaStopIcon(), func() {}),
)
},
func(id widget.ListItemID, item fyne.CanvasObject) {
task := tasks[id]
item.(*fyne.Container).Objects[0].(*widget.Label).SetText(fmt.Sprintf("Task ID: %d", task.ID))
buttonRun := item.(*fyne.Container).Objects[1].(*widget.Button)
buttonStop := item.(*fyne.Container).Objects[2].(*widget.Button)
buttonStop.Disable()
buttonRun.OnTapped = func() {
fmt.Println(fmt.Sprintf("Task ID: %d Start button pushed.", task.ID))
startTask(task)
buttonRun.Disable()
buttonStop.Enable()
channelTask <- task
return
}
buttonStop.OnTapped = func() {
fmt.Println(fmt.Sprintf("Task ID: %d Stop button pushed.", task.ID))
task.Chancel()
buttonRun.Enable()
return
}},
)
}
func createTasks() []*Task {
var tasks []*Task
for i := 0; i < 5; i ++ {
tasks = append(tasks, &Task{ID: i})
}
return tasks
}
